This roof took damage from hurricanes Laura and Delta. Insurance claim was made, and our customer was finally able take action in 12/22! With multiple leaks every time it rained, the manager said she was ready to stop chasing buckets. So, coating was the most affordable and fastest option. Especially since it’s an operating business, we didn’t want to have to shut down and cause loss of business during the busy season.
This particular product is special. It’s a gypsum and castor oil mixture (two-part mixing system) and has incredible adhesion to the roofing surface. NO NEED FOR PRESSURE WASHING! Make sure all loose debris and organic growth is removed and moist areas are dry, prep roof, and finally coat!
Our customer had the doors painted.
Unfortunately, a primer was not applied first which caused the paint to feel off easily.
Our process: Doors were stripped, primed and painted correctly.
